Compare all specifications:

1984 Citroen CX 2007 Lamborghini Murcielago
Make Citroen Lamborghini
Model CX Murcielago
Year Released 1984 2007
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 1995 cc 6496 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 12 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 105 HP 631 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 8000 RPM
Torque 159 Nm 660 Nm
Torque RPM 3250 RPM 6000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 86.1 mm 88 mm
Engine Stroke Size 85.5 mm 89 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.0:1 11.2: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type Front 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1225 kg 1740 kg
Vehicle Length 4670 mm 4620 mm
Vehicle Width 1770 mm 2060 mm
Vehicle Height 1370 mm 1140 mm
Wheelbase Size 2750 mm 2670 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 5.2 L/100km 21.3 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 80 L 100 L
